Transaction 34edd242c106594a439a486f48143c428e1eea17c9bf2728694e6d35d34b8adc

1 Input
2 Outputs
  • 34edd242c106594a439a486f48143c428e1eea17c9bf2728694e6d35d34b8adc:0
  • value  16149
    address  3D8qFzyUjiKxJ3jJwqgQy7Z6Zjkp7bGB5L
  • 34edd242c106594a439a486f48143c428e1eea17c9bf2728694e6d35d34b8adc:1
  • value  52811
    address  bc1qte3jde3pqqnkcnhfu56xwwlkpfu4lp983mwd5e